Note Editore

A precursor of modern academic journals, this quarterly periodical, published between 1810 and 1829 and now reissued in forty volumes, was founded and edited by Abraham John Valpy (1787–1854). Educated at Pembroke College, Oxford, Valpy established himself in London as an editor and publisher, primarily of classical texts. Edmund Henry Barker (1788–1839), who had studied at Trinity College, Cambridge, became a contributor and then co-editor of this journal, which fuelled a scholarly feud with the editors of the Museum criticum (1813–26), a rival periodical (also reissued in the Cambridge Library Collection). Although its coverage overlapped with that of its competitor, the Classical Journal also included general literary and antiquarian articles as well as Oxford and Cambridge prize poems and examination papers. It remains a valuable resource, illuminating the development of nineteenth-century classical scholarship and academic journals. Volume 15 contains the March and June issues for 1817.




Sommario

Part XXIX. Peri tou phoinikos; Collatio codicis Harleiani 5674; Desultory remarks on Juvenal; Observations on Maltby's edition of Morell's Thesaurus prosodiacus; De graecis Novi Testamenti accentibus; Klotzii Libellus; Notice of Hermanni elementa doctrinae metricae; Cambridge tripos for 1789; Latin poem; Remarks on the similarity of worship; On the caesura; On the Sapphic and Alcaic metres; On a passage of Livy; Notice of Ouvaroff on the Eleusinian mysteries; Some observations on the worship of Vesta; Adversaria literaria; Dr Crombie's remarks; Loci quidam Luciani; Notice of Sir W. Gell's Itinerary of the Morea; Sappho emendata; Prologus in Eunuchum; Epilogus; Additional remarks relating to the inscription upon the column of Diocletian at Alexandria; Extracts from Arcadius Grammaticus; Bentleii epistola; Correspondence; Annonce de Xenophon; Greek poem; Metrical lines contained in various prose classics; Literary intelligence; Notes to correspondents; Part XXX. Hebrew Criticisms; On the demon of Socrates; Longevity of men of letters; On the style of the ancient Greek epigram; Barkeri epistola critica; Bibliography; on the Sapphic and Alcaic metres; Gryphiadaea; De l'improvisation poetique; Some observations on the worship of Vesta; The shipwreck of St Paul; Instance of Arabian forgery; De carminibus Aristophanis commentarius; Collatio codicis Harleiani 5674; Miscellanea classica; On the originality of Kuster's discovery; Additional remarks on Arcadius Grammaticus; Translation from Timocreon; Greek Sapphic ode; Greek and Latin epigrams; The translation of Arrian's Periplus; Researches made among the ruins of Pompeii, in 1813; Certain modern opinions respecting the Troad; Mohammedes; On the derivation of 'antea,' etc.; Stackhousii emendationes; Curae posteriores; Adversaria literaria; Encore quelques mots de la colonne de Diocletien; Greek letter of Langton; Literary intelligence; Notes to correspondents.
